Oracle layoffs have once again highlighted an important reality for IT professionals in India — job security in global tech companies is not permanent, and financial preparedness matters more than ever.

Here are the key areas every IT professional should focus on:

1. Emergency Corpus

Maintain at least 6–12 months of expenses in a liquid fund or savings account. This ensures you can manage EMIs, lifestyle costs, and basic needs without stress during job transitions.

2. Personal Health Insurance

Do not depend only on employer insurance. Once job ends, coverage stops immediately. A separate health insurance policy for self and family is non-negotiable for financial safety.

3. Asset Allocation

Avoid over-exposure to equity or illiquid investments. A balanced mix of equity, debt, and liquid assets helps manage risk during income uncertainty.

4. Step-Up SIP Strategy

Instead of one-time high investments, follow a step-up SIP approach. Gradually increase SIPs with income growth so that wealth creation continues even during career uncertainty.
In today’s IT industry, financial resilience is as important as technical skills.
